Nas really does have an album done. The only thing he is waiting on is the right time to drop it.

Hip-Hop fans all over the world started salivating when they saw that Nas had a new song on DJ Khaled’s Major Key album called “Nas Album Done.” What some of us thought was just a song is now a foreshadow as Nas has revealed that he actually does have a new body of work ready to go.

But he is taking his time with releasing it though. In an interview with Complex, QB’s finest revealed his plans for the album:

Musically, the internet is going crazy over “Nas Album Done.” Tell me about the genesis of the track. Did DJ Khaled come to you?

Khaled hit me up and said that he wanted to do this and we had planned some studio days to sit down and we cleared some studio days just to go over records. He knew exactly what he wanted. He had a couple of ideas, but the one we put out, that was the one he really wanted.

Was it your idea to sample Fugees’ “Fu-Gee-La?”

No, that was all Khaled. I texted Ms. Lauryn Hill to ask her if she was cool, she said she was cool. She signed off on it, she gave me the approval. I don’t have the rest of the Fugees’ phone numbers, so I hit Salaam Remi who worked with the Fugees and he signed off on it. I just wanted to get her blessing and we were good.

So is it true then? Is the album done and ready to go?

All we’re doing now is plotting when we’re dropping.

Do you have a title and an idea of when it might come out?

Yes, but it’s not time to put that out there.

Before we get all excited let us not forget about how Nas said he had album done in his verse on ScHoolboy Q’s “Studio” remix back in 2014. It’s been two years since then and he haven’t seen anything close to a Nas album coming out.
